Tony Hawk responds to claim he married on Jeffrey Epstein’s island


Tony Hawk is clearing the air on speculation that she married a conv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epsteinthe private island

“Here are my nuptials facts and timelines,” the 57-year-old professional skateboarder wrote via his Instagram story on Thursday, February 5, per people. “And I apologize if they don’t fit a nonsense narrative.”

Hawk has been married four times and broke the timeline of his multiple life events. The athlete married the first wife Cindy Dunbar in Fallbrook, California in 1990. Three years after her divorce from Dunbar in 1993, Hawk married Erin Lee at the San Diego Hilton Hotel.

After her 2004 split from Lee, Hawk moved on Lhotse Merrim. The couple held their wedding ceremony on Tavarua Surf Island in Fiji in 2006. Following his 2011 divorce from Merriam, Hawk founded The One with his wife. Catherine Goodman. The couple married at Adare Manor in Ireland in 2015. None of the locations Hawk listed was Little Saint James, which was Epstein’s private estate in the US Virgin Islands.

Hawk claimed the confusion came from one of the guests at his 2006 wedding to Merriam. One of the guests was allegedly a photographer named Mark Epstein. Jeffrey happens to have a brother named Mark, but Hawk claimed that his wedding guest is no relation to the late financier’s family. (Epstein killed himself at age 66 in August 2019 after being arrested on federal sex-trafficking charges. He previously pleaded guilty to procuring a child for prostitution and solicitation of a minor in 2008, and served 13 months in prison.)

“One of the guests in 2006 took pictures of the ceremony in Fiji and licensed them to Getty Images,” explained Hawk. “His name is (coincidentally) Mark Epstein. An accomplished action sports photographer from Wyoming and no relation to Jeffrey Epstein (whom I never met and whose island I never visited). This is all easily verifiable information. Facts are not fungible.”

Hawk concluded his message by apologizing to his friend Mark for “the vortex of misinformation.”

After the US Department of Justice released Epstein’s files last month, rumors swirled that Hawk was involved after the skater was mentioned in an October 2024 email from an FBI agent. The officer was investigating a case of child trafficking.

The email said the victim claimed she was “taken from Ireland and taken to Jeffrey Epstein’s island when she was 13” and “was there when Prince Edward was there and when Tony Hawk got married on the island”.
